概括
在盐度压力下,草植物的生长和光合作用减少. 分子分析揭示了与细胞壁,和离子运输相关的基因和代谢物的变化,为改善盐耐受性提供了目标.

背景情况:
- (Medicago sativa) 是一种重要的料作物,由于土壤盐度增加,面临产量损失.
- 了解草对盐度的分子反应对于提高作物弹性至关重要.
研究的目的:
- 调查的生理,转录和代谢反应,以盐度压力.
- 为了确定基底的分子机制的对盐水条件的反应.
主要方法:
- 对Medicago sativa cv.的生理学评估 在盐水和对照条件下的海.
- 叶子组织的转录和非向的代谢分析.
- 长时间暴露 (3-4周) 盐度处理.
主要成果:
- 在盐度下显著减少了的生长和光合作用.
- 鉴定了1233个差异表达的基因和60个差异积累的代谢物.
- 观察到细胞膜/细胞壁,, osmoprotectants 和抗氧化途径的变化.
结论:
- 度压力影响了的生理和分子特征.
- 关键的途径包括离子运输,保护性蛋白质和转录因子.
- 识别的分子变化为提高的盐分耐受性提供了目标.

Adaptations that Reduce Water Loss
25.7K
Though evaporation from plant leaves drives transpiration, it also results in loss of water. Because water is critical for photosynthetic reactions and other cellular processes, evolutionary pressures on plants in different environments have driven the acquisition of adaptations that reduce water loss.

Tonicity in Plants
30.7K
Plant cells maintain appropriate osmotic balance in extreme conditions. For instance, plants in dry environments store water in vacuoles, limit the opening of their stoma, and have thick, waxy cuticles to prevent unnecessary water loss. Some species of plants that live in salty environments store salt in their roots. As a result, water osmosis occurs in the root from the surrounding soil.
